THE ZONING PRECEPTS WERE READ BY Mr. Talbott to OPEN THE PUBLIC HEARING at approximately 7:02 p.m. Case S-1, Michael Lee Hughes, S-12-007 – Mr. Talbott opened the public hearing at approximately 7:03 p.m. Mr. Shelton, Director of Code Compliance, reported Michael Lee Hughes had petitioned for a Special Use Permit on 2.00 acres, located on State Road 883/Campview Road, in the Chatham-Blairs Election District for placement of a single- wide mobile home for a family member’s residence. Mr. Shelton further reported the Planning Commission, with no opposition, recommended granting the petitioner’s request. Mr. Hughes was present to represent the petition and stated he lived on this road, the area was sparsely populated and there are six single-wide homes and six double-wide homes in the immediate area. Mr. Hughes further stated he did not believe placement of this home would have a negative effect on property values. There was no opposition to the petition. Mr. Talbott closed the public hearing at approximately 7:04 p.m. The Board discussed the petition as the Committee of the Whole and determined there were no adverse effects. During the discussion, it was stated this placement was consistent with the area. Board of Zoning Appeals June 12, 2012 Page 2 Upon motion of Mr. Estes, seconded by Mr. Reynolds, the following motion was adopted: Whereas, Michael Lee Hughes has petitioned the Board of Zoning Appeals for a Special Use Permit for placement of a single-wide mobile home for a family member’s residence and, Whereas, we find no substantial detriment to adjacent property, that the character of the zoning district will not be changed thereby, and that such use will be in harmony with the purpose and intent of the Ordinance, I move the Special Use Permit be granted. Motion passed unanimous. This concludes the Special Use Case.
